Teapot and cover of soft-paste porcelain with creamy-white translucency; London shape, oblong with spreading foot, bulbous body, waisted neck and concave shoulder; square handle with internal spur; spout of triangular section; plateau-shaped lid, with pyramidal knop with gadroon-moulded band round the middle. The body fire-cracked, the glaze badly blistered, especially inside and outside the base and inside the spout. Glazed but not decorated.
